The average development engineer software gross salary in Manitoba, Canada is $117,550 or an equivalent hourly rate of $57. This is 7% lower (-$9,095) than the average development engineer software salary in Canada. In addition, they earn an average bonus of $5,243. Salary estimates based on salary survey data collected directly from employers and anonymous employees in Manitoba, Canada. An entry level development engineer software (1-3 years of experience) earns an average salary of $82,276. On the other end, a senior level development engineer software (8+ years of experience) earns an average salary of $132,907.

Based on our compensation data, the estimated salary potential for Development Engineer Software will increase 13 % over 5 years.
This chart displays the highest level of education for:
Development Engineer Software, the majority at 62% with bachelors.
Typical Field of Study: Computer Programming, Specific Applications

View Cost of Living PageManitoba is a province of Canada at the longitudinal centre of the country. It is Canada's fifth-most populous province, with a population estimated at 1,507,057 in 2025. Manitoba has a widely varied landscape, from arctic tundra and the Hudson Bay coastline in the north to dense boreal forest, large freshwater lakes, and prairie grassland in the central and southern regions.
